Subject: Partner SFTP drop — new owner

Hi,

As you review the pending changes to the Harborline ingest scripts, note that ownership of the partner SFTP drop is changing at the end of the month. This includes key rotation, the nightly pull job, and the quarantine folder for malformed files. Review comments on the retry logic should still go through the normal PR flow, but questions about drop-folder conventions or partner onboarding now go to the new owner. The incoming owner is listed below.

signatory, tagaf-bahaf: Praael Fenmir Rusok

## Further Reading

Telemetry payloads from Nightjar agents are compressed with a custom dictionary-trained scheme before upload. Security-relevant details: dictionaries are versioned, signed, and fetched over the internal mesh only; decompression is bounded at 8 MiB to prevent expansion attacks. The threat model, fuzzing results, and dictionary rotation procedure are documented on the page below.

operations page: https://confluence.tolvaqsys.corp/spaces/pages/pages/6e787158f507

Runbook — Ledgerpane audit-log viewer

If the viewer shows stale entries, restart the indexer pod first, not the frontend. Check ingest lag; anything over five minutes means the tailer stalled. Escalate to the Brightmoor platform rota only after a second restart fails. The indexer picks up the following configuration on boot.

settings of bawif-fawif:
ralix:
  log_level: warn
  metrics_host: metrics.ralix.tolvaqsys.internal
  pool_size: 32